Consists of a series of 28 checked and edited procedures that describe in detail the preparation of generally useful synthetic reagents, intermediates or products or exemplify important new synthetic methods of expected broad applicability and significances. Chemoselective and stereoselective general synthetic techniques, optimized preparations of reagents currently not available commercially and preparation of enantiomerically pure materials beginning with readily available enantiomerically pure natural substances are among the topics covered.
